Do you wish to better the world? Join us on 18 November as teams of LSE aspiring change makers pitch their poverty-ending, disruptive startup solutions to the social challenge of overcrowding in urban spaces for USD 1 million in seed funding. In teams of 3-4, these LSE change makers will pitch a startup solution to double the incomes of 10 million people globally within a 5 year timeframe. They will face off in front of a distinguished judging jury, including Sir Christopher Pissarides, esteemed academics, professionals from the private and public sector such as Andrew Boff the Conservative leader of the London Assembly, Charlotte Young from the School of Social Entrepreneurs and Bonnie Chiu from Lensational.
